> Fink asks you to make choices during the install process.
>
> If you have installed teTeX independently of Fink (using Gerben Weirda's
> distribution which accompanies TeXShop) then when you are asked to make
> a choice, you should always choose system-tetex.
>
> If you have not installed teTeX independently of Fink, then when you are
> asked to make a choice you should never choose system-tetex.

The problem is actually not that simple.  Observe:

tetex-base depends on tetex-texmf
system-tetex provides tetex-texmf
tetex-base conflicts with system-tetex

The only way I managed to get tetex installed was to use Weirda's
installer and to have fink install the tetex-system package.
